He wanted to pray to a higher power. His fight went to the highest court

The justices are considering whether Grand can challenge the permit demand before a final denial, a ruling that could broaden religious zoning fights.

Summary by KESQ
By John Fritze, CNN (CNN) — Daniel Grand wanted to host a small prayer session at his home near Cleveland. Instead, he wound up on a four-year pilgrimage to the Supreme Court. Grand, an Orthodox Jew, had invited about a dozen people to his rec room in early 2021 for a minyan, a prayer gathering The post He wanted to pray to a higher power.
